Debdas Len

 Upload a photo

Nearby cities:
Coordinates:   23°7'10"N   88°28'25"E
  •  59 km
  •  105 km
  •  139 km
  •  154 km
  •  229 km
  •  250 km
  •  262 km
  •  334 km
  •  409 km
  •  451 km
This article was last modified 15 years ago